At the very least, there are bits of Monaco, Singapore, and Baku that don't meet the minimum for new circuits, at least, new permanent circuits. Track minimum is supposed to be no less than 12m, and the grid is supposed to be at least 15m wide.

Then again, track width is supposed to be maintained through Turn 1, and overall should not decrease at more than a certain rate. Austin, Buddh, Sochi, Nurburgring, Hockenheim, Fuji, and Suzuka, at a minimum, all violate these in some way.

An exception doesn't bother me so much, if there is a clearly-stated, understandable reason for it. However, it needs to actually be an exception for use in just a few cases. It's becoming the rule when half the tracks on the calendar need an exception for a rule, or related set of regulations.

Thinking about it again, I think at least the run through the trees from Turn 5 to 6 at Albert Park may not be quite at the 12m minimum. A good part of Monza is not that wide, as well as at least most of the main stretch at Spa, from a little after La Source all the way to Les Combes, and that may extend all the way until the entry to Stavelot after the right/left at Les Fagnes. A majority of the lap at Montreal probably doesn't meet the 12m requirement either.

And this is to say nothing of the off-camber and/or banked corners at Austin, Istanbul, and maybe some other places also. Speaking of Istanbul, and circumventing rules, Turn 8 is kind of an attempt to get around the stuff regarding/limiting decreasing-radius corners. Austin also plays a little fast and loose with this in its stadium section. Alternatively, just look at Massenet at Monaco, the Interlagos infield, or the third sector of the re-modeled Fuji.

Bear in mind that there is no need for exceptions as the FIA does not have rules or regulations for track design - they are guidelines and the final call is down to the track inspector appointed by the FIA: as you say yourself, the 12m guideline is for permanent tracks, there is not always the room on a temporary track.
